Caregiver Responsibilities:

  • Provide patient care under direction of nursing staff
  • Provide companionship and basic care to clients
  • Maintain a clean and healthy environment
  • Assist with ADLs to clients (bathroom functions, bathing, grooming, dressing, and eating)
  • Assist in the transport of clients
  • Build rapport with our clients; engage in conversation and provide companionship

Applicant Requirements:

  • No experience required
  • Valid Driver’s license and insured automobile
  • Ability to work every other weekend
  • Legally able to work in the United States
  • Must be able to pass criminal background checks
  • Must be able to pass a drug screening
  • High school diploma or equivalent
